Understanding Weight Loss



It’s all about creating a caloric deficit.

The key ingredients of fat loss are:
- What you eat daily
- Staying active regularly

Together, these factors help your body maintain muscle mass.

What to Eat to Lose Weight



Diets come in many forms, but the most effective ones are sustainable.

Nutrition rules that work:
- Eat whole, unprocessed foods
- Don’t overeat even healthy foods
- Sometimes thirst is mistaken for hunger
- Limit added sugars and refined carbs
